
    ^h                         S /r SSKrSSKrSSKrS r\S:X  aj  S\R                  ;  a4  \R                  S   S-   \R                  S'   \" S5        \R                  S	  \R                  " \R                  S5        \" 5         gg! \ a     Nf = f)main    Nc                     SSK Jn   SSKJnJn  SSKJn  UR                  SS9  UR                  S5        [        R                  S:X  a3  [        R                  " [        R                  [        R                  5        UR                  S	[        R                  5        [        R                  R!                  S
5      n[        R                  SU n[        R                  S   /[        R                  US-   S  -   [        R                  S S & UR                  S[        R                  5        US   nUR#                  S5      u  ptnUR%                  S5        U(       d  UR'                  5       nUn[)        U5      nU R+                  Xx5        U R,                  R/                  5         UR0                  b+  [        R2                  " UR0                  R4                  5        g g )Nr   )launcher)logsockets)debuggeezdebugpy.launcher)prefixz%debugpy.launcher startup environment:win32zsys.argv before parsing: {0}z--   zsys.argv after patching: {0}:z[])debugpyr   debugpy.commonr   r   debugpy.launcherr   to_filedescribe_environmentsysplatformsignalSIGINTSIG_IGNinfoargvindex
rpartitionstripget_default_localhostintconnectchannelwaitprocessexit
returncode)	r   r   r   r   seplauncher_argvadapterhostports	            S/home/james-whalen/.local/lib/python3.13/site-packages/debugpy/launcher/__main__.pyr   r      sU    +)KK)K*DE
||w
 	fmmV^^4 HH+SXX6
((..
CHHQsOM88A;-#((379"55CHHQKHH+SXX6 AG((-ODtJJt,,.t9DT #!!,,- $    __main__r   z/../../ )__all__localer   r   r   __name__modulespath
__import__	setlocaleLC_ALL	Exception r*   r)   <module>r7      s   
 (   
%.P z, #hhqkI-9HHQK+ 	FK >   		s   B BB